All Jane Wants is a Nice Cup of Tea

tea.jpg

Jane has recently been on a whirlwind tour of television stations across the United States. Normally a mild-mannered sort, all of this traveling has caused Jane to get a bit cranky. So, a column about one of her pet peeves seems justifiable, even during this happy holiday season.

Jane has already flushed out her thoughts on airport bathrooms in another entry. So, let's move on to the concept of the in-room coffeemaker. It's a beautiful thing...for coffee drinkers. But hey, hotel companies, what about the tea drinkers? Where are our teabags? Not only do millions of us drink tea, but even non-tea drinkers like teabags for their ability to reduce travel-induced bags under the eyes.

Jane has often found that if there is actually a teabag in the hotel coffee caddy, it's an herbal one. Herbal tea isn't even really tea, for goodness' sake. Many tea drinkers rely on their morning cuppa for their wake-up dose of caffeine. Please give us the real stuff. Furthermore, please provide something other than a Lipton teabag. No offense to Lipton, but if the coffee drinkers get Wolfgang Puck or Starbucks, surely the tea drinkers should be treated to Tazo or other notable potable brands.

Of course, even if there is a caffeinated teabag on hand, after the water has come through the coffeemaker, one's tea frequently attains a lovely plastic flavoring. What about a device that boils water without the added taste? After all, in Japan, where tea drinking is an art form, hotels have dedicated tea makers. Water is heated to just the right temperature and the tea tastes delightful. A traveler shouldn't have to travel all the way to the Far East for a decent cup of in-room tea. Tea drinkers of America, unite. Perhaps we need to create an updated version of The Boston Tea Party to make the point--this lack of real tea is quite taxing to us. Give us decent-tasting, caffeinated tea or give us liberty. Tea from Liberty of London would suffice.
